Essentially, you will find five basic types of home remodeling projects: home maintenance, curb appeal, neighborhood norm, appraisal booster, lifestyle improvement, and “green” improvement. For the record, some of these improvements could intersect with others, but overall, the ones which might be most vital to consider are home maintenance and appraisal booster.

Home maintenance repairs are those that would manage the home’s condition and are pretty routine to the lifecycle of almost every home. Home maintenance renovations would include projects like roof repairs, flashing roof leak repair, weather-stripping, and storm door repairs. If your gutters, plumbing fixtures, and other “everyday” shelter need required work, these would all fall under the umbrella of normal home maintenance and repair.

Appraisal boost renovations provide a quick turnaround and prepare a home for quick flip investments. Appraisal – focused renovations do not seek to over-improve your home, but simply increase the value of one’s home through major remodels that upgrade the good quality of life in the home to a competitive and comparable level in line with the market comps. In other words, you’re remodeling to “meet the Joneses,” not outdo them. Here’s an example:

Let’s say you purchase a 3 bed, 2 bathroom home in Todt Hill, which is a relatively middle-class community in Staten Island, New York. Once you purchased the home several years ago, it was relatively normal for all the homes to have 3 bedrooms and 1.5 bathrooms. Now, you’re looking to sell the home and move to New Jersey. Having said that, you discover that recent homes that have sold within the Todt Hill area are 3 bedrooms 2.5 bathrooms, and granite countertops. Guess what? You’ll probably have to consider renovating your property to add a full bathroom and see about receiving granite countertops to match the current market place demands.
